
NEWARK, New Jersey (WABC) -- A man was killed after being attacked by three pit bulls in Newark.
Police say they were called to Georgia King Village near Cabinet Street around 8:30 p.m. Saturday, after reports of a man being attacked by dogs.
Officials say the victim stepped in after seeing the three pit bulls fighting. The dogs, which are owned by someone the victim knows, then turned on him.
Authorities say the victim managed to escape, but lost consciousness after being bitten. He was later pronounced dead.
Animal Control was notified and responded to the scene, but it is unclear if they took custody of the dogs or if the owner will be charged.
